What is weight loss?

Achieving weight loss is a primary objective for many individuals across the US who aim to enhance their overall health and well-being. This process entails deliberately reducing excess body fat by adopting a thoughtful blend of nutritional modifications, increased exercise, and significant lifestyle changes. More than just appearance, maintaining a healthy weight plays a crucial role in preventing and managing various obesity-related health issues, leading to a better quality of life.

What are the key differences between Mounjaro & Wegovy?

What is Mounjaro?

The newest FDA-approved treatment for weight management and type 2 diabetes.

Includes tirzepatide, a medication that acts on two important hormones: GLP-1 and GIP.

This dual-action approach helps suppress appetite while also supporting better blood sugar regulation.

Intended to deliver improved results when used alongside lifestyle modifications.

What is Wegovy?

Approved for weight management in adults who are overweight or obese.

Contains semaglutide, a GLP-1 receptor agonist medication.

Works by mimicking a natural hormone that influences the brain’s appetite regulation centers.

Supports reduced hunger and calorie consumption to encourage long-term weight loss.

How do the chemical compositions of oral treatments differ from those of injectable medications?

Although oral and injectable weight loss medications can contain the same active ingredient (like semaglutide), their chemical formulations are specifically tailored to their method of delivery. Injectable medications are administered directly into the bloodstream, while oral medications must withstand the digestive process, resulting in different designs to maintain their effectiveness.

Key distinctions include:

  • Injectables bypass the digestive tract, allowing for more efficient absorption; oral medications often require absorption enhancers.
  • Oral tablets are formulated with protective coatings and carriers to withstand stomach acid.
  • Injectables are often chemically more stable, especially for peptide-based drugs.
  • Injectables generally allow for higher drug levels in the blood.
  • Oral tablets contain more excipients (binders, coatings, etc.) than injectables.
Do oral medications offer the same effectiveness as injectable treatments?

Oral weight loss medications can be effective, but they don’t always function identically to injectable treatments. Even when containing the same active ingredient, oral medications are absorbed differently, which can slightly impact how much of the drug is available to work in the body.

That said, for many individuals, oral options offer a convenient and clinically effective alternative.

Key points:

  • Oral medications may deliver lower drug levels into the bloodstream compared to injectables.
  • Higher oral doses are often used to make up for reduced absorption.
  • Clinical trials show that oral semaglutide (like Rybelsus) can produce weight loss comparable to injections in some individuals.
  • For those who prefer to avoid injections, oral treatments provide an effective option when taken as directed and consistently.

Dry and irritated skin occurs when the skin loses moisture or its natural protective barrier is disrupted. Common causes include environmental factors such as cold weather, low humidity, or excessive exposure to water and harsh soaps. Skin conditions like eczema or psoriasis can also contribute, as well as aging, which reduces the skin's natural oil production. In some cases, dehydration, poor diet, or certain medications may play a role.

Diagnosis

Dry skin is often diagnosed based on its appearance and symptoms, such as flaking, redness, or a rough texture. Irritated skin may also show signs of inflammation, itching, or sensitivity. If the condition is persistent or severe, a healthcare professional may examine your medical history and perform tests to rule out underlying skin conditions like dermatitis or allergies.

Treatments

- Regularly applying a hydrating moisturiser can restore the skin’s natural barrier and lock in moisture. Choose products free of fragrances or irritants for sensitive skin.

- Limit exposure to hot water, harsh soaps, or chemicals that can exacerbate dryness.

- Severe cases may require medicated creams or ointments, such as corticosteroids for inflammation or prescription emollients for chronic dryness.

Prevention

To prevent dry and irritated skin, use gentle, fragrance-free products for cleansing and moisturizing. Protect your skin from harsh weather by using appropriate clothing and applying sunscreen to exposed areas. Avoid hot showers or baths, which can strip the skin of natural oils, and maintain hydration by drinking plenty of water. Incorporating a diet rich in essential fatty acids, like omega-3s, can also support healthy skin.

Is it better to use lotion, cream, or ointment for dry skin?

The choice depends on the severity of your dryness. Lotions are lightweight and good for mild dryness, while creams are thicker and provide more hydration for moderately dry skin. Ointments are the most effective for severe dryness or cracked skin, as they create a protective barrier to lock in moisture.

Can dry skin make other skin conditions worse?

Yes, untreated dry skin can lead to itching, which may cause scratching and damage to the skin barrier, increasing the risk of infections or exacerbating conditions like eczema or psoriasis. Keeping your skin hydrated is key to managing dryness and preventing complications.

Does aging make skin more prone to dryness?

Yes, as we age, the skin produces less oil, which naturally helps retain moisture. This makes older adults more prone to dryness and irritation. Using richer moisturizers and gentle cleansers can help address this change and maintain skin health.

Are certain fabrics better for dry or sensitive skin?

Yes, wearing soft, breathable fabrics like cotton is better for dry or irritated skin, as they minimize friction and allow air circulation. Avoid rough or synthetic materials, which can cause irritation or worsen dryness.
